Daytime Privacy
V 38 SR CDF - Dual Reflective increases exterior reflectance in daylight, helping street-facing Philadelphia glass feel more private without blocking the view from inside.
V 38 SR CDF is the moderate dual reflective choice, stronger than V 48 but still far from the darkest privacy films. It gives the exterior a more defined reflective presence during daylight, while the interior side remains less reflective than standard reflective film. That balance is the main reason to specify dual reflective technology.
In Philadelphia, V 38 fits Center City ground-floor retail, lobby glass, professional offices, restaurants, and mixed-use entrances where daytime privacy and glare control matter but clear interior views still matter after sunset. It is also useful for street-facing residential windows when occupants want more separation from sidewalk traffic without choosing a very dark film. The result is a film that can serve both tenant comfort and storefront presentation, especially where people work or gather close to the glass. It also gives owners a clear upgrade path from subtle privacy to stronger privacy without immediately changing the entire feel of the room.
The specs are 38% VLT, up to 61% heat rejection, and over 99% UV block. The blue-gray dual reflective appearance helps reduce glare and solar heat, and the lower interior reflectance improves night-view comfort compared with one-way mirror style films. The tradeoff is that the exterior appearance will be noticeable, especially in direct daylight.
Choose V 38 when V 48 is too subtle and V 28 would be too dark for the room or facade. It is the practical center of the dual reflective range: enough privacy to change how the glass performs at street level, but enough daylight and view quality to keep interiors comfortable through a full Philadelphia workday.

Lower interior reflectance makes the room less mirror-like after dark than standard reflective films, a practical difference in high-rise and restaurant glass.
At 38% VLT, it cuts visible glare and rejects solar heat for conference rooms, storefronts, and west-facing facades.
| VLT | 38% |
|---|---|
| Heat Rejection | up to 61% |
| UV Block | over 99% |
| Warranty | Residential lifetime / Commercial 15yr |
| Series | Dual Reflective Series |
| Brand | Vista |
